The invention discloses a battery module structure. The structure comprises an aluminum plate internally provided with a cooling channel and a plurality of insertion holes vertically formed in the aluminum plate, cylindrical battery cells are inserted into the insertion holes, the cooling channel is filled with silicone oil, a cooling channel opening is formed in the side wall of the aluminum plate, and the cooling channel opening is communicated with the insertion holes through the cooling channel; when a battery is at a high temperature, the low-temperature cooling liquid flows through the aluminum plate cooling channel for convective heat exchange and then takes away battery heat conducted by the aluminum plate; and when the battery needs to be preheated, the thermal-state cooling liquid transfers heat to the aluminum plate, so that the battery pack is preheated. The temperature management problem of the battery pack can be solved, and the battery pack temperature equalization capability is improved.
